My Spouse
I met my future husband, Ray DeYong, at Leo's on Main Street in Hackettstown. We've been married 37 years, it hardly seems possible. He's an over-the-road trucker so we have limited home time together.
My Kids
My daughter Kathleen (Kate) is 35 and lives in Ohio with my two grandsons, Jacob 11 and Davin 8, and my great son-in-law, David Mione, who is full-time US Army Reserves stationed in Mansfield, Ohio. (much closer than Utah, where they had been for the last eight years.)
My daughter Patricia (Patti) is 33 and married to a terrific guy, Karl Andreas, and lives about 15 minutes from us. They have 6 yr. old Emilee and RaeAnna Robin who is 3.
My Job
For nine years I was the secretary to the high school principal in our local school district. How ironic, for someone who hated school as much as I did. Even better is that I started out as the attendance secretary!

Workplace
Once my children started school I decided to go to work. I worked part-time delivering flowers for Greenway Flowers in Hackettstown. Then I went to the US Postal Service in Hackettstown and was a rural mail carrier until moving to PA in 1987.
My girls were in early adolescence when moving to PA and I was going to be a stay at home Mom.....that got boring after 6 months and I went job hunting. I ended up working as a florist for 3 years. Then I became a secretary for Penn State Cooperative Extension, Bloomsburg, PA for 2 yrs. Then I started working at the high school in Benton, PA where my one daughter was still in school. I continue to work in the district at the administrative office and just completed my 17th year.
My parents are living in Easton as do my sisters Donna, Terri and Patti. Nancy is the only one still in Hackettstown, and Sharon lives in Frenchtown, NJ. Amazingly, we are all still married to our original spouses... lol Life has been good to me; life is good.
